Advanced Ingredient Science
Modern retinoid formulations utilize encapsulation technology and time-release mechanisms to deliver active ingredients gradually, reducing irritation while maintaining efficacy. Professional formulations often combine different retinoid types to target multiple cellular pathways simultaneously, producing comprehensive anti-aging effects.
Stabilized vitamin C formulations represent another breakthrough in professional skincare technology. L-ascorbic acid, while highly effective, requires careful formulation to maintain stability and potency. Professional products utilize advanced stabilization systems including magnesium ascorbyl phosphate and sodium ascorbyl phosphate to ensure consistent antioxidant delivery and collagen synthesis stimulation.
Peptide Classification and Applications
Professional peptide therapy encompasses multiple categories, each targeting specific aspects of skin aging. Signal peptides stimulate collagen and elastin production, carrier peptides deliver essential minerals to skin cells, and neurotransmitter peptides help reduce muscle contractions that contribute to expression lines. Advanced formulations often combine multiple peptide types to create comprehensive anti-aging effects.

Combination Therapy Approaches
The most effective professional skincare protocols often combine multiple treatment modalities to address different aspects of skin aging simultaneously. For example, morning antioxidant therapy protects against environmental damage while evening retinoid treatments stimulate cellular renewal. Weekly chemical exfoliation enhances the penetration and effectiveness of daily active ingredients.
Synergistic ingredient combinations can produce results greater than individual components alone. Vitamin C and vitamin E work together to provide enhanced antioxidant protection, while retinoids and peptides complement each other by addressing both cellular turnover and structural protein synthesis. Professional formulations are specifically designed to maximize these synergistic effects while minimizing potential interactions.
Professional vs. At-Home Treatment Integration
Optimal anti-aging results typically require integration of professional in-office treatments with consistent at-home care protocols. Professional treatments such as chemical peels, microneedling, and laser therapy provide intensive intervention, while daily at-home products maintain and enhance results between professional sessions.
The timing and selection of professional treatments should complement at-home routines to maximize benefits while minimizing downtime and potential complications. For example, professional chemical peels are most effective when preceded by several weeks of at-home retinoid conditioning, which prepares the skin for more intensive intervention.
